在Linux系统中,部署Java web应用程序是一个常见的任务。在这个过程中,使用Tomcat作为web服务器并使用WAR文件(Web应用程序归档)进行部署是一种常见的做法。在本文中,我们将讨论如何在Linux系统中使用Tomcat和WAR文件来部署Java web应用程序。

首先,让我们简要介绍一下Tomcat。Tomcat是一个开源的Java Servlet容器,可用于运行Java web应用程序。它是一个轻量级的服务器,被广泛用于部署Java web应用程序。

WAR文件是一种打包格式,用于将Java web应用程序打包成一个单独的文件。WAR文件包含所有的web应用程序代码、库文件和配置文件。使用WAR文件可以方便地将整个web应用程序部署到Tomcat服务器中。

下面是在Linux系统中使用Tomcat和WAR文件部署Java web应用程序的步骤:

1. 下载和安装Tomcat:首先,你需要下载Tomcat的最新版本并解压缩到你的Linux系统中的某个目录中。然后,设置JAVA_HOME环境变量指向Java安装目录,并启动Tomcat服务器。

2. 创建一个WAR文件:将你的Java web应用程序打包成一个WAR文件。确保WAR文件包含所有的必要文件和配置信息。

3. 部署WAR文件到Tomcat:将WAR文件复制到Tomcat的webapps目录下。Tomcat会自动解压WAR文件并部署你的web应用程序。

4. 启动Tomcat服务器:通过执行startup.sh脚本(在Tomcat的bin目录中)启动Tomcat服务器。

5. 访问你的web应用程序:在浏览器中输入http://localhost:8080/你的应用程序名称来访问你的web应用程序。

通过以上步骤,你就可以在Linux系统中使用Tomcat和WAR文件来部署你的Java web应用程序了。这种部署方式简单方便,并且能够帮助你快速地将你的web应用程序部署到服务器上。祝你部署成功!